I've not seen Colombian Ramshorn, but you're aware that they eat plants, right? They even eat other snails.
Regarding MTS, your nearest aquarist should have some, or your nearest petshop. Basically they're extremely common. They don't eat plants and are great at scavenging leftover fish food, but do eat fish-eggs, so if you're going to breed egg-laying fish you don't want these guys in there.
